Japan selects the F-35A in the F-X competition

December 19, 2011

Japan's Security Council selected the F-35A as winner of the F-X competition, with an initial order of forty-two aircraft to replace its F-4EJ Phantom IIs. The Lightning II beat the Eurofighter Typhoon and the F/A-18E/F Super Hornet. The agreement provided for part of the production to be assembled in Japan by Mitsubishi Heavy Industries.
